DS Lites have been in the stockrooms of your local electronics stores for about 2 weeks. Targets, Wal-Marts, and other stores sold the devices before the not-so-strickly-imposed launch data of June 11.
Nintendo made a few calls and put a stop to those stores selling the DS Lites. The stores that sell the DS Lites early can get charged mega-fees for each DS Lite sold before the street date. So, the stores implemented their own systems to prevent the DS Lites from being sold before June 11.
